systraq (0.0.20081214-1) unstable; urgency=low
* st_snapshot no longer defaults to using md5sum. st_snapshot.hourly makes
st_snapshot use sha256sum if available. lib/rr-localdigest, as called by
systraq, no longer runs md5sum but sha256sum. Therefore, your old checksum
files will no longer be used and (unless precautions are taken) systraq
will complain about changes in monitored files.
See the "UPGRADE INSTRUCTIONS" in the news about systraq version 20081214
in /usr/share/doc/systraq/NEWS.gz for upgrade instructions. As long as
you haven't upgraded your systraq configuration, you'll get email messages
from cron every hour. If you'd rather not receive these reminders, run
# touch /etc/systraq/i_want_a_broken_systraq
. Before you actually start performing the manual upgrade, remove this
file.
-- Joost van Baal <joostvb@debian.org> Wed, 17 Dec 2008 00:57:02 +0100
